Would be funny if the +1 step colder plugs WERE causing the random misfire. So essentially, the 350z HR spark plugs are 1+ step colder for the 350z DE. The 370z plugs are 1+ step colder for the 350z HR. I kept them on the stock 370z gap... since they are iridium and it is difficult to gap those without destroying the electrode.
